Role Description

The post holder will be responsible for the summative and formative Internal Verification of candidates at The Haven Wolverhampton, ensuring Awarding Body Standards are met and achievement is timely.  

Main Duties & Responsibilities

  • To ensure all Awarding Body procedures are being complied with, and that the award of credit and qualifications to learners is secure.
  • To maintain a system to monitor assessment practice and maintain standardisation of assessment judgement, ensuring assessors make valid decisions and learners are assessed fairly to ensure consistency.
  • To maintain files and up to date records, sampling plans relating to assessors and internal verification carried out.
  • To be responsible to monitor the quality of assessment through the sampling of assessment practices and decisions.
  • To ensure that assessment is appropriate, consistent, fair, and transparent and does not unintentionally discriminate against any learner.
  • To ensure tutors/assessors receive on-going advice and support, for example in designing assessment activities and receive clear and constructive feedback on their work.
  • To participate in regular standardisation/network meetings to ensure compliance with the Centre’s procedures and regulatory body requirements.
  • To promote good practice and abide by all The Haven Wolverhampton’s policies and procedures.
